Stress caused by social media
By participating in social media such as Instagram, WhatsApp, and the like, we are always up to date, reachable, and can participate in various conversations simultaneously. The constant accessibility, the social pressure to constantly compare ourselves with others, cyberbullying, data protection issues, and much more can lead to health problems if our usage behavior is poor. As the issues affect young people and adults, pupils and teachers should use the teaching unit to examine the topic critically.
